Rather an unusual performance took :place today. During :the morning hour. soon after the Senate met. under the order of business of petitions. the Senator from Arizona [Mr. As~uasHU rose and announced that he proposed to see to it that *the Senate should take a vote on the immigration bill before the session is over. Following suit. the distinguished Senator from Montana made the same announcement. and yet. upon .a motion to take it up .a few days ago a solid Democratic vote I recorded "nay " and a solid Republican vote is recorded "yea This -vote will.be found at page 11873 of the CoNoaEssSIONA RECORD of July 31. It is .interesting to note that upon that rdf call the distinguished Senators who announced today that the proposed to have a vote on the bill are recorded as not voting. but. as I have said. every vote to table the motion to take :up the Immigration !bill was .a Democratic vote. and every vote against tabling that motion was a Republican vote. The am.bassadors of sovereign States obey the Executive lmandate ad caucus decree :rather than :the -peQples will. Ti .peple :themsdlves will pass upon the :record .thus -made.
